Scarlet fever is a bacterial infection caused by a group a streptococcus. Scarlet fever is a disease which can occur as a result of a group a streptococcus group a strep infection, also known as streptococcus pyogenes. Typical symptoms are sore throat, headache, fever, flushed face with a ring of pallor about the mouth, red spots in the mouth, coated tongue with raw beefy appearance and inflamed papillae underneath it strawberry tongue, and a characteristic rough red rash on the skin.
